Seemed pretty knowledgeable about gf (but could have been better). When I went they had a limited menu, but I was able to order the gf pasta Alfredo and it was delicious! They did include bread on my to go order (in a separate area of the container, so no CC) but I assumed it wasn't gf bread and that seemed like a silly oversight since I was ordering with so many precautions. However, yummy options and super friendly staff. I'd go back to try the pizza!

First time eating at Paesano’s. They have gluten free pasta and pizza options. Tried the Sicilian pizza and it was the closest I’ve come to a glutenous pizza in years. I didn’t experience any problems (celiac) so I feel safe eating here again.

lots of options, but make sure you let them know you are celiac and not just sensitive. polenta fries are not safe unless you tell the wait staff specifically. Zuppa and Italian chop are pretty safe options

I love this place. Delicious food, but beware! They do not have dedicated fryers, so while they offer GF polenta fries they are certain to be cross-contaminated.

I have loved Paesanos for years and would give 4 or 5 stars for their regular menu. However, their GF pizza is the worst I have had (and I have tried at least a dozen). The sauce and toppings are fine, but the crust is awful like cardboard. I couldn't force myself to finish it. Truly,it's bad compared to ANY other GF pizza in Sac or SF. Also, the GF gemelli spinaci advertised is misleading as they do not have GF gemelli! Instead they serve undercooked GF penne. Great restaurant, quite poor GF menu.

I love Paesanos. They try real hard for the Celiacs. However be warned, they do make GF Calamai but they do not have a dedicated fryer. If you are truly sensitive that is a pretty big cross contamination. Join us and start requesting for them to buy a separate fryer! Enough of us ask and they'll take action!! Also they do not make GF salad dressings (all they have to is use rice, wine or apple cider vinegars) or use Tamari. Join us and bug them!! Together we can make a good place great for Celiacs!!!!

Pasta and bread passed Nima test (no gluten). 2 pizzas did not pass Nima test (gluten found). Great service and experience otherwise. They did not charge us for pizzas and gave us vouchers for next visit. Clearly something wrong with their protocols with pizza prep. If you have celiac, bring a tester or avoid this place.

Offers a "Gluten Intolerant" menu. The GF pasta is only spaghetti and is used in all the pasta dishes. The pasta dishescome with a side of toasted GF bread, but i forgot to ask if it was from a shared toaster. For appetizers, I've tried the calamari fritti (my favorite) and haven't had any issues. I was told they only use gluten free flour for the calamari, but it does state on the menu that it is "prepared in common fryer oil." The fried ravioli and bocce balls on the regular menu are likely sharing the same fryer oil. I have not tried the GF pizza or sandwiches yet, but they are offered on the GF menu too. The dessert menu is limited - only GF options are ice cream or gelato.

When ordering, be sure to specify that the dish needs to be gluten free. The staff was friendly and answered all my questions.

If you have kids, they may bring out a small ball of dough for the kids to play with while waiting for the meals. It is made with wheat flour, so not safe for kids who are gluten free.

Overall, I had a great experience and the food was delicious.
